The automation is where I cannot make things work as you indicate: When I add an Automation lane to the track my choices are:
https://goo.gl/photos/Vr1DMbwwAa34WCsE9
 (This is the link to a screenshot)
 
This is where I was expecting CC1 along with Volume and Pan.



Aha! It looks like you're using an Instrument track there. For reasons others can better explain, you should instead use separate MIDI and Audio tracks for your soft synths like Kontakt. Then, you can add the automation to the MIDI track. Here, it looks like it only offers a limited selection of options because it's not giving you any MIDI-specific choices. (The documentation here implies that Automation on an Instrument Track is only available to the Audio half, which tallies with what we're seeing in your case.)
 
The docs do say you can split an Instrument track into to separate ones via: "Click the Track view > Tracks menu > choose Split Instrument Track." Try that, then try adding automation lanes to the MIDI track?

You guys are more sophisticated.  I just Insert a range of controllers in either track or staff view.  If I just need one event, I make the start and end times and values the same.  I do this for controllers and pitch wheels.

I'm not sure that what I do is any more sophisticated than that! If I know I can just draw an event, I could just create the Automation lane and add the relevant node. I guess it's a bit more complex if I want to ride the automation myself, eg. to see how the synth responds. But that's not much different - make sure I'm using the correct CC value, record automation while changing that value, then convert to an Automation lane for convenient further editing.
